Trafalgar Italy Land Tours 2025. Book your 2025 italy tour with confidence. Book your 2025 italy and sicily tour with confidence.

20+ italy tour packages operated by trafalgar during 2025/2025, having customer 5 reviews. Book your 2025 italy tour with confidence.
Trafalgar Italy Land Tours 2025 Images References :